In this episode, Adam is joined by Marlise Anthonioz, who discusses openly how her meditation practice has taken her from a place of depression and hopelessness to a joyful optimism, enabling her to live a full and happy life. She discusses how family life was causing her to feel unhappy and unfulfilled and how her Buddhist meditation practice transformed her experience. A desire to understand the deeper meaning of life led her to search and question others. She discovered that meditation was the pathway through which she could open her heart to truly love her partner and be a better mother to her children. This podcast will inspire those who feel overwhelmed by family life to see how it can become a way of achieving our potential to love and to feel genuine happiness.
Having been born in Cameroon and raised in poverty, Marlise is now the teacher at Centre Boudhiste Lyon in France.
